Catholic schools are encouraged to show excellence in their work in ways which demonstrate a distinctive Gospel understanding of "excellence". This is based on a Christian anthropology which regards each person as being uniquely gifted with talents and capacities which should be developed to their full potential. Success is not measured merely in terms of academic attainment but in signs of personal development and actions which show a commitment to meeting the needs of others.
A Charter for Catholic Schools
The Charter for Catholic Schools has been developed to define the key characteristics of excellence which should be found in every Catholic school in Scotland. Each of these is more fully developed in the resource 'Shining the Light of Christ in the Catholic School'.
